#942e4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#942e4c is composed of 58% red, 18%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.9% magenta, 48.6%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 342.4 degrees, a saturation of 52.6% and a lightness of 38%. #942e4c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5c98 with #290000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#942e4c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#942e4c has RGB values of R:148, G:46,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.49,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9711180.

Shades and Tints of #942e4c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0407 is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#942e4c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#675b5e is the less saturated color, while #c1013a is the most saturated one.
